Confirmed for Gamescom 2022, Outlast Trials gives fans a taste of the psychological horror to come.

Outlast is a series that constantly pushes the boundaries when it comes to horror games and offers gamers all kinds of spooky encounters. Red Barrels’ original entry in the Outlast series debuted in 2013, and players take on the role of investigative reporter Miles Upshur, who is trapped while investigating the Mount Massive Asylum mental institution. We’ve since seen the DLC Outlast: Whistleblower and its sequel to Outlast 2, 2017. Now, a new take on the stressful horror will be released later this year – The Outlast Trials.

Host Jeff Quigley announced that the “new look” will be showcased at Gamescom 2022 as part of Opening Night Live.

Fans can tune in live on Tuesday, August 23 at 2 p.m. ET.

Outlast Trials is the prequel to the first two games in the series and plays out a bit differently. In the Cold War era, players have the option of playing with friends in co-op or continuing the game alone. This will be the first time the Outlast franchise has featured multiplayer, and fans are ready to see how it affects the horror experience.

“In a world of insecurity, fear, and violence, your morals will be questioned, your stamina tested, and your sanity shattered,” reads the game’s official description.
